Top 5 Food and Drink Apps on iOS in Italy - Q1 2024

The first quarter of 2024 saw interesting trends among the top 5 Food and Drink applications on iOS in Italy. Here's a detailed look at their performance based on data from Sensor Tower.

Die Thermomix® Cookidoo® App from Vorwerk International & Co. KmG exhibited a noteworthy performance in terms of weekly revenue and active users. The app's weekly revenue peaked at around $16K in early January and experienced fluctuations throughout the quarter, ending at approximately $12K by the end of March. Weekly downloads for the app showed a peak of 3.5K in early February, followed by a gradual decline, concluding with 2.8K in the last week of March. Active users remained relatively stable, starting at 58.3K and ending at 58.7K.

Gronda from Gronda GmbH had a mixed performance. Weekly revenue experienced a significant peak at $1.6K in late February, with other weeks fluctuating between $0.6K and $1.3K. Downloads remained steady, averaging around 400 per week, with the highest being 522 in early March. Active users showed a consistent trend, starting at 555 and ending at 534.

Vivino: Buy the Right Wine by Vivino ApS demonstrated stable performance in weekly revenue, maintaining an average of around $300, peaking at $441 in the first week of January. Weekly downloads saw a significant drop from 4K in the first week of January to around 1.1K in mid-quarter, with a slight increase to 1.8K by the end of March. Active users started at 21.1K and saw a slight decline, ending the quarter at 19.4K.

Wine-Searcher from Wine-Searcher Ltd showed modest revenue trends, averaging around $250 per week, with a peak of $296 in late February. Downloads were stable, averaging around 250 per week, and active users remained consistent, starting at 539 and ending at 457.

Sale&Pepe from Stile Italia Edizioni S.R.L. had a varied performance. Weekly revenue showed a significant spike to $1K in the last week of March, following a period of low earnings. Downloads remained low throughout the quarter, peaking at 101 in the first week of January and dropping to 18 by the end of March.
